Conformation and growth mechanism of the carbon nanocoils with twisting form in comparison with that of carbon microcoils

2003 
Abstract Carbon nanocoils with twisting form were grown by the Ni/Al 2 O 3 -catalyzed pyrolysis of acetylene. The conformation and the tip morphologies of the carbon nanocoils were examined in detail. The growth schematics of the carbon nanocoils relating to the catalyst rotating were proposed, comparing with that of the carbon microcoils. The driving force of the coiling of the straight fibers to form carbon nanocoils was considered to be the strong catalytic anisotropy of the carbon deposition between different crystal faces, and causing the different rotation way from that of carbon microcoils.
